Suspect in 2019 Machete Attack Still Unfit for Trial

Grafton Thomas is still deemed mentally unfit to stand trial. On Wednesday January 17, over four years after Green Wood Lake resident attacked the home of Rabbi Chaim Rottenberg, Thomas’ trial was again postponed while he continues to receive psychiatric treatment. K9 Unit sniffs out domestic abuse suspect

During the evening hours of Thursday January 11, the Clarkstown Police Department responded to a residence in Nanuet for reports of a physical altercation between two adult males in the street. Local cafe sets stage for musicians

Nineteen years ago, Nyack, NY became home to Art Cafe. For 15 of those years, the Tel Aviv inspired restaurant and cafe has been holding live music events, featuring a variety of musicians.
